Project - Politics In Design
Outcome - Michael Jackson print pyjamas and labels
Commentary -
I followed the Michael Jackson court case for this project.
On the final day of my coverage Michael Jackson appeared late to court
wearing hospital pyjama trousers. To commemorate this day and comment
on his use of showmanship to distract press attention from the
testimony of his prosecutions main witness, I chose to make a pair of pyjamas. The pyjama pattern features stencilled iconic images of Michael Jackson from his most famous periods, which was a contrast to
his image of frailty and insecurity throughout the trial. The pyjamas
are intentionally non-judgemental regarding an opinion on Michael
Jacksons guilt in the trial. The text on the label is from a newspaper
story on the day. This also represents no positive or negative viewpoint on the story.
